Women's ODI Most Runs Conceded off an Over
Back To: Records->Womens_ODI->Overall->Bowling
(‡ after runs indicates eight-ball overs, † after runs indicates contrived circumstances)
Runs | Bowler | Details | Batsmen | |||
29 | Fahima Khatun | (1/66466) | AJ Sutherland / AM King | Bangladesh Women v Australia Women | Shere Bangla National Stadium, Mirpur | 2023/24 |
28 | A Khaka | (1/4644X44) | H Kaur / SS Mandhana | South Africa Women v India Women | De Beers Diamond Oval, Kimberley | 2017/18 |
The list above shows occurrences of 28 runs or more
The following symbols are used in the details:
W = wicket
B = bye
L = leg-bye
X = wide
* no-ball
** no-ball in matches where the playing conditions stipulated 2 runs for a no-ball
/ indicates the batsman changed ends
For extras the number of additional runs precedes the symbol, so for example 4B indicates 4 byes, 4X indicates a wide which went to the boundary so five runs in all, 4B* indicates a no ball missed by the batsman so five no balls in all
Before 2000 no extras were given for a no ball from which runs were scored
